What You’ll Need to Make This Recipe
This cake uses everyday ingredients that come together beautifully. Eggs provide structure and help the cake rise, while sugar adds sweetness and tenderness.
Milk keeps the batter smooth and moist, and oil ensures a soft texture that stays fresh longer. A combination of cornstarch and flour gives the cake its light yet stable crumb.
A touch of baking powder helps everything rise into a soft, airy cake.

How to Make The Famous 6 Cup Cake Step by Step
Step 1: Preheat and Prepare
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F) and grease a cake pan.
Step 2: Measure with One Glass
Use the same glass for all ingredients to keep proportions correct. Crack the eggs into the glass first to set your measurement.
Step 3: Mix Wet Ingredients
In a large bowl, whisk the eggs, sugar, milk, and oil until smooth and well combined.
Step 4: Add Dry Ingredients
Add the cornstarch, flour, and baking powder. Mix gently until the batter is smooth and free of lumps.
Step 5: Pour and Bake
Pour the batter into the prepared pan and smooth the top.
Step 6: Bake
Bake for 35–40 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
Step 7: Cool and Serve
Let the cake cool slightly before slicing. Serve warm or at room temperature.

How to Store
Store the cake covered at room temperature for up to 3 days.
You can also refrigerate it for longer freshness or freeze slices for up to 2 months.

Frequently Asked Questions
What size glass should I use?
Any standard glass works, ideally around 200 ml, as long as you use the same one for all ingredients.
Can I replace the oil with butter?
Yes, melted butter can be used for a richer flavor.
Can I add flavors?
Absolutely—vanilla, lemon zest, or even chocolate chips work well.
Why use cornstarch?
It helps create a softer, lighter crumb in the cake.
The Famous 6 Cup Cake
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 40 minutes
Total Time: 50 minutes
Servings: 8–10 slices
Ingredients
- 3 eggs (measured using a glass)
- 1 glass sugar
- 1 glass milk
- 1 glass oil
- 1 glass cornstarch
- 1 glass all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 180°C (350°F) and grease a pan.
- Whisk eggs, sugar, milk, and oil.
- Add cornstarch, flour, and baking powder.
- Mix until smooth.
- Pour into pan.
- Bake 35–40 minutes.
- Cool slightly before serving.
